Enhancing Safety Features of Medical Facility Beds



Enhancing safety attributes in health center beds is essential for individual well-being and stopping mishaps. When you choose a hospital bed, search for features like side rails, which can assist protect against drops, particularly for those with minimal flexibility. Bed height changes additionally play an important duty; they allow less complicated gain access to for both people and caregivers, lowering the danger of injury during transfers.Additionally, think about beds furnished with alarm that signal staff when a person attempts to stand up unassisted. This can supply prompt assistance and stop possible crashes. Non-slip surfaces on the bed and around the area can further improve safety and security, supplying security for individuals relocating in and out of bed.Lastly, make sure that the bed has safe and secure locking devices on wheels to avoid any kind of unintentional movement. By focusing on these safety functions, you can create a much safer environment that sustains not just recuperation yet overall patient confidence.

Bed Material Option



Picking the appropriate products for hospital beds is crucial, especially since they straight effect infection control and hygiene. You require to assess products that are non-porous and simple to tidy. Metal structures often stand up to germs and are resilient, while premium plastic or vinyl surface areas can offer a smooth, sanitary surface. Avoid products that catch dampness or are susceptible to scratches, as these can nurture hazardous pathogens. Furthermore, seek antimicrobial coatings that help in reducing the threat of infection. When selecting bed linens, choose cleanable, sturdy materials that endure constant laundering without breaking down. Your choices play a substantial role in preserving a tidy and safe atmosphere for individuals, helping them recuperate more successfully and minimizing the danger of hospital-acquired infections.


Normal Cleansing Protocols



To ensure a secure setting for clients, carrying out regular cleaning procedures is essential in infection control and hygiene. You require to establish a routine cleaning routine for medical facility beds, concentrating on high-touch surface areas such as hand rails, side panels, and cushion joints. Use EPA-approved disinfectants to successfully remove virus and establish they're applied properly for maximum effectiveness. Don't fail to remember to educate personnel on correct cleansing methods, emphasizing focus to information and thoroughness. Normal audits can aid maintain conformity and identify areas requiring enhancement. By staying constant with these procedures, you not only enhance client safety but likewise add to a much healthier healing atmosphere. Keep in mind, a tidy hospital bed is basic in advertising general client well-being and preventing healthcare-associated infections.

What Are the Weight Purviews for Health Center Beds?



Medical facility beds generally sustain weight limits varying from 350 to 600 pounds, relying on the design. It's necessary to inspect details producer standards to guarantee safety and security and stability for the person utilizing the bed.
